What Are the 3 Most Common Procurement Traps to Avoid?
Focusing only on upfront unit price will leave you facing 3x higher total operating costs over the machine lifespan. Many new buyers entering the post-sanction supply space default to comparing quoted prices first, without auditing the underlying credentials that prevent costly downtime and operational disruption later.
| Procurement Factor | High-Risk Common Practice | Verified Recommended Practice |
|---|---|---|
| Certification & Warranty | Accept verbal warranty promises without documented proof of compliance | Require formal CE/EPA certification and written warranty terms aligned to industry standards [NEED_CITE: Uncertified construction machinery accounts for 41% of unplanned downtime incidents in Russian mining operations] |
| Operational Compatibility | Order off-the-shelf standard models without adjusting for local temperature and terrain | Prioritize suppliers that offer configurable parts to match -40°C winter operation and uneven unpaved work sites |
| Spare Parts Access | Assume all suppliers offer global parts support | Select suppliers with pre-positioned stock in regional warehouses to avoid 3+ week lead times for critical components |
A regional equipment distributor based in Almaty told us last quarter that they initially ordered 12 wheel loaders from a small unvetted supplier for a road building contract, only to find no formal warranty and no local parts stock when 3 units experienced hydraulic failures within the first 2 months of use. They ended up paying 27% of the original order value in emergency international shipping fees to get replacement parts, and missed their project delivery deadline by 18 days. Working with a established exporter on their second 24-unit order cut their total parts-related cost for the fleet to less than 2% of the order value over the same operational window [NEED_CITE: Localized spare parts stock reduces average equipment downtime for CIS users by 78%].

- Certification Verification – Request physical copies of CE and EPA test reports for every model you are evaluating, not just general company documentation.
- Warranty Alignment – Confirm that warranty terms cover both parts and labor for the full stated period, with no hidden exclusions for heavy use in mining or high-altitude sites.
- Parts Lead Time Confirmation – Ask for specific delivery timelines for the 5 most commonly replaced components for your selected machine type, before finalizing any order.

How Do You Calculate True Long-Term Ownership Cost?
Upfront purchase price makes up less than 40% of the total cost of operating a construction machine over a 5-year lifespan. Many buyers make the mistake of only comparing quoted unit prices when evaluating offers, without accounting for the cumulative cost of parts, maintenance, and unplanned downtime that can add tens of thousands of dollars per machine over its use period.
To build an accurate cost model, you will need to combine four core variables: initial acquisition cost, recurring spare parts expenditure, scheduled maintenance fees, and estimated revenue loss from unplanned downtime. For example, a 5% difference in quoted unit price can be completely erased by a single 10-day downtime event for a critical unit on a time-bound construction contract. Established export-focused suppliers with local parts stock consistently deliver lower total lifetime cost even if their base unit price is slightly higher than unvetted alternatives, due to the reduced downtime and lower parts shipping fees [NEED_CITE: Total cost of ownership for construction machinery is 35% lower for users with local spare parts access].

- Base Acquisition Cost – Record the final delivered price including all shipping and customs clearance fees for every candidate unit.
- Spare Parts Budget – Multiply the expected annual parts consumption by the quoted delivery timeline and shipping cost for each supplier.
- Downtime Projection – Estimate the daily revenue loss for each machine type, then multiply by the average expected downtime per year for each supplier offering.
